Vendor Quality Control Analyst evaluates vendor operations, products, and services for compliance with government and company quality standards. Conducts audits and testing of products, materials, and processes to measure effectiveness and compliance with company expectations. Being a Vendor Quality Control Analyst analyzes and monitors metrics and KPIs to suggest improvement initiatives. Works with vendors and identifies alternative vendors to mitigate risks and resolve problems. Additionally, Vendor Quality Control Analyst assists with drafting and negotiating service-level agreements to ensure performance/quality metrics, responsibilities, expectations, and penalties are adequately defined. Prepares reports and updates on vendor status and quality.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. The Vendor Quality Control Analyst occ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. Gaining ex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. To be a Vendor Quality Control Analyst typically requires 2 -4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Duties/Responsibilities:
Evaluate to ensure that all required processes and guidelines are followed to ensure the delivery of the highest levels of customer experience while driving quality to outperform our critical targets.
Attend call audit workshops, monitor calls as prescribed guidelines, provide feedback to the management team, identify, and highlight modes in the process; and identify unethical practices/behaviors.
Submit necessary additional requests from the quality control department to support operations.
Participates in the design of call monitoring formats and quality standards.
Performs call monitoring, identifies, and reports trend data; and prepares and analyzes internal and external quality reports for management staff review.
Uses quality monitoring data management system to compile and track performance at team and individual level.
Provide coaching and feedback related to evaluated transactions to team members.
Participates in customer and client listening programs to identify customer needs and expectations.
Works collaboratively with the client during calibration sessions ensuring the QA.
Coordinates and facilitates call calibration sessions for call center staff on key metrics to improve performance.
Respond promptly to all escalations made by the contractual client or the final client via telephone, email, text messages or chat.
Service customers via phone, email, and chats as and when required.
